What is a mobile app?

A Mobile App job involves designing, developing, testing, and maintaining applications for mobile devices such as smartphones and tablets. Professionals in this field work with programming languages like Swift, Kotlin, and Flutter to create user-friendly and functional apps. They may collaborate with UI/UX designers, backend developers, and product managers to ensure seamless app performance. Mobile app jobs can be found in various industries, including tech, healthcare, finance, and gaming.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the mobile app position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Mobile App Developer, you need a solid background in programming languages such as Swift, Kotlin, Java, or Dart, as well as a thorough understanding of mobile platforms like iOS and Android. Familiarity with development tools such as Xcode, Android Studio, and version control systems (e.g., Git) is typically required, and certifications in mobile development can be advantageous.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ective collaboration skills help you excel in cross-functional, fast-paced environments. These skills collectively ensure efficient app development, high-quality user experiences, and successful project delivery.

What are the typical challenges faced by mobile app developers in their day-to-day work?

Mobile App Developers often encounter challenges such as keeping up with rapidly evolving mobile technologies and platform updates, optimizing app performance across diverse device types, and ensuring data security. Collaborating with designers, backend developers, and quality assurance teams to create seamless user experiences can also present coordination challenges. Debugging complex issues and responding to user feedback or ratings are regular parts of the job, requiring adaptability and resilience. Developing effective solutions to these challenges is a key factor in delivering successful, user-friendly mobile applications.
